mysql8.0怎么改中文 mysql更新中文

导读:
MySQL是一种关系型数据库管理系统,广泛应用于各个领域 。中文在现代社会中越来越重要,因此 , 在MySQL数据库中更新中文数据也变得非常必要 。本文将介绍如何在MySQL中更新中文数据 。
1. 确认字符集
在MySQL中,字符集是非常重要的,因为它决定了如何存储和处理数据 。在更新中文数据之前 , 需要确认数据库的字符集是否支持中文字符 。可以使用以下命令来查看当前数据库的字符集:
SHOW VARIABLES LIKE 'character_set%';
如果发现字符集不支持中文字符,可以使用以下命令更改字符集:
ALTER DATABASE database_name CHARACTER SET utf8;
2. 更新中文数据
更新中文数据与更新其他类型的数据类似 。可以使用UPDATE语句来更新中文数据 。例如,要将名字为“张三”的用户的电话号码更新为“123456789”,可以使用以下命令:
UPDATE users SET phone_number='123456789' WHERE name='张三';
3. 转义特殊字符
在更新中文数据时,需要注意转义特殊字符,以避免SQL注入攻击 。可以使用MySQL提供的转义函数来转义特殊字符 。例如,要将名字为“李'四”的用户的电话号码更新为“987654321”,可以使用以下命令:
【mysql8.0怎么改中文 mysql更新中文】UPDATE users SET phone_number='987654321' WHERE name=CONCAT('李', "'", '四');
总结:
在MySQL中更新中文数据需要确认字符集是否支持中文字符 , 使用UPDATE语句来更新数据,并注意转义特殊字符以避免SQL注入攻击 。

    推荐阅读